6 Ways to Reduce Water Used for Irrigation |
If your utility bill keeps rising, you might need to keep track of the amount of water your irrigation system uses. Likewise, in light of water scarcity (which affects many areas), it might be prudent to look into ways to conserve the water we use for irrigation.
Efficient water application reduces wastage. For instance, proper placement of sprinklers can ensure the planted area is uniformly irrigated. Rather than running your sprinkler longer to cover dry spots, work on ensuring accurate head spacing or alignment to improve distribution and promote efficiency.
Also, periodic checks can let you find leaks or bottlenecks in the system that could be wasting water. In turn, timely repair of such leaks would ensure an efficient system and hopefully, reduce water usage.
